ホームページ >ウェブフロントエンド >jsチュートリアル >Hacktoberfest に参加して、初めてのオープンソースに貢献しましょう!

Hacktoberfest に参加して、初めてのオープンソースに貢献しましょう!

Linda Hamilton
Linda Hamiltonオリジナル
2024-10-05 10:33:02639ブラウズ

Join Hacktoberfest nd Make Your First Open Source Contribution!

今年もこの時期がやってきました!ハクトーバーフェストが開催されます。開発者、特に初心者にとって、オープンソースの世界に飛び込む絶好の機会です。コーディングやオープンソースの初心者にとって、Hacktoberfest は学び、成長し、コミュニティに貢献するための素晴らしい方法です。

オープンソースに貢献する理由

  1. 現実世界のエクスペリエンス: オープンソースに貢献することで、現実世界の問題を抱えた実際のプロジェクトに取り組むことができます。ポートフォリオを構築するのに最適な方法です。
  2. 学習の機会: 他の開発者から学び、大規模なコードベースがどのように構造化されているかを確認し、共同開発がどのように機能するかを理解できます。
  3. ネットワーキング: オープンソース コミュニティには才能のある人々がたくさんいます。これは、つながりを作り、質問し、アドバイスを得るのに最適な方法です。
  4. 気分が良い: 自分のコードが他の人の役に立っていると知るとやりがいを感じます!

私のプロジェクト: トークタイマー – 初心者に最適

私は ハクトーバーフェストの対象で初心者に優しい小さなオープンソース プロジェクトを持っています。これは トーク タイマー という Next.js アプリ です。このアプリは、設定可能な警告と終了時刻を備えた、トーク用のシンプルなタイマーです。また、F/f キーを使用して全画面モードを切り替えて、プレゼンテーション中に気が散ることがないようにすることもできます。

デモ: https://talk-timer.vercel.app
Github リポジトリ: https://github.com/dnafication/talk-timer

オープンソースを始めたばかりの場合、または単純なものに貢献したい場合は、このプロジェクトには初心者向けの問題が用意されています。 JavaScript に慣れている人でも、React や Next.js の世界に足を踏み入れたい人でも、ここにはあなたのための何かがあります。

参加方法

  1. リポジトリをフォークする: GitHub の Talk Timer リポジトリに移動し、フォークして開始します。
  2. 問題を確認してください: 現在、すべての問題は初心者向けであり、ハックトーバーフェストに対応しています。これらは、最初の貢献として取り組むことができる、小さくて管理しやすいタスクです。
  3. 貢献してください: プル リクエストを送信すると、Hacktoberfest の完了に向けて順調に進んでいきます!
  4. 途中で学習: 行き詰まっても心配しないでください。お気軽に質問してください。私は喜んでお手伝いいたします。オープンソース コミュニティは新しい貢献者を歓迎し、喜んでお手伝いします。

Hacktoberfest は、オープンソースの旅を始める素晴らしい機会です。飛躍して、今月を成長と貢献の月にしましょう!

コーディングを楽しんでください! ?

Unsplash のYurii Khomitskyi によるカバー写真

以上がHacktoberfest に参加して、初めてのオープンソースに貢献しましょう!の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。